Metric Abstract Elementary Classes (MAECs) correspond to an amalgam of the notions of Abstract Elementary Classes (AECs) and Elementary Class in the Continuous Logic. In this work, we study a proof of uniqueness (up to isomorphism) of Limit Models in MAECs [ViZa10a, Za1x], under superstability-like assumptions.
